The Role Of Temperature In Preventing Legionella Growth

Legionella is a type of bacteria that can cause a severe form of pneumonia known as Legionnaires’ disease This bacteria thrives in water sources, particularly warm water, making cooling towers, hot tubs, and plumbing systems prime breeding grounds In order to prevent the spread of Legionella, it is crucial to understand how temperature plays a key role in its growth and proliferation.

Temperature is a critical factor in controlling the growth of Legionella bacteria Legionella bacteria grow best in water temperatures between 77-108°F (25-42°C) This temperature range is often referred to as the “danger zone” for Legionella growth When water temperatures fall below 77°F, Legionella bacteria can still survive but their growth is significantly slowed down On the other hand, when water temperatures exceed 108°F, Legionella bacteria can be killed off.

One of the most effective ways to prevent Legionella growth is by maintaining water temperatures outside of the danger zone This can be achieved through proper design, maintenance, and operation of water systems For example, keeping hot water tanks at temperatures above 130°F can help prevent the growth of Legionella bacteria However, it is important to note that water temperatures above 120°F can scald and cause burns, so precautions should be taken to prevent accidental exposure to high temperatures.

Hot tubs and spas are also at high risk for Legionella contamination due to their warm water temperatures To prevent the growth of Legionella bacteria in hot tubs, it is important to maintain proper disinfection levels and regularly clean and sanitize the water Keeping hot tub temperatures above 104°F can help prevent Legionella growth, as bacteria are less likely to thrive in hotter water.

In addition to maintaining proper water temperatures, other control measures can be taken to prevent Legionella contamination These may include regular cleaning and disinfection of water systems, ensuring proper ventilation and airflow, and implementing water treatment programs Education and training on Legionella prevention can also help raise awareness and promote best practices for controlling the bacteria.
